Barn directly adjacent to west of Manor Farmhouse

GV II

Barn. Early/mid C18. Flemish bond red brick, double-Roman tile roof, coped verge to road with a finial. Right-angles to road. Single storey and attic; irregular openings with wooden lintols, some restored with iron and concrete, some plank doors. Paired carriage openings with central lias pillar. Hay-loft opening in gable face of road frontage. Included primarily for group value with Manor Farmhouse (qv).
